Image appeal following burglary in Bournemouth

Officers investigating a burglary at a residential address in Bournemouth are issuing an image of a woman they would like to identify.

At around 1.50pm on Wednesday 26 November 2025 entry was forced to a home in Swanmore Road while it was unoccupied and various items were stolen including a toolset and a blue satchel containing keys.

Police Constable Luke Booth, of Bournemouth police, said: “We have been carrying out enquiries into this burglary and have obtained an image of a woman we would like to identify as part of our investigation.

“I would urge anyone with information regarding her identity to please contact us.”

Anyone with information is asked to contact Dorset Police online or by calling 101, quoting occurrence number 55250174719. Alternatively, independent charity Crimestoppers can be contacted anonymously online using its website or by calling Freephone 0800 555 111.
